Take a Look Into Your Future at Pacifica Continental

  • Perform recruitment of professionals for our clients by developing a recruitment strategy, sourcing candidates, CV screening, phone screening, face to face and online interviews;
  • Managing the recruitment process through interviews to offer stage and beyond;
  • Networking in order to build business information that can be converted into our business portfolio;
  • Search and attract candidates through databases, hunting, and social media;
  • Meet potential new clients (C-levels, directors, and HRs from several industries) to present Pacifica Continental´s services understanding the client needs and business opportunities;
  • Manage recruitment processes with Pacifica Continental clients.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ree completed;
  • Advanced English;
  • Previous experience in the recruitment business (headhunting) is a plus;
  • Strong Hunter profile with proven track records;
  • Performance-oriented willing to work with financial targets;
  • Ability to self-organize and work with autonomy;
  • Strong communication and relationship skills.
